Abstract

In the context of my country’s full effort to build pumped storage power stations, my country has the ability to independently research and develop pumped storage power stations, and has set a development goal to manufacture pumped storage units with larger single-unit capacity and higher speed. Generator motors play an important role in the safe and stable operation of power systems, and have a significant impact on power grids and power stations. This paper establishes a physical model of the damping winding of the generator motor, simulates the change of electrical parameters when a short-circuit fault occurs in the no-load operation of the generator motor, and obtains and analyzes the change rule, which has great theoretical and practical significance.
